How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Randolph County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Randolph County Studio Apartments | $719 | $719 | $719 |
| Randolph County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$961 | $700 | $1,330 |
| Randolph County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,140 | $850 | $1,300 |
| Randolph County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,406 | $1,350 | $1,462 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Randolph County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Randolph County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Randolph County is $961.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Randolph County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Randolph County is a 670 square feet unit starting from $925 at Arlington Apartments.
